The VAUXHALL OMEGA (1995-03) 4DR SALOON 2.2I 16V CDX AUTO is a classic executive saloon that offered a comfortable and refined driving experience during its production years. Positioned as a reliable and well-equipped family or business car, this model is known for its spacious interior, smooth ride, and solid build quality. It’s particularly popular among those who value comfort over sporty performance, making it a great choice for daily commuters or family outings. The model's stylish design and practical features have helped it stand out in the saloon car market, offering a more upmarket alternative within the Vauxhall range at the time. Considering its reputation for reliability and comfortable driving, the VAUXHALL OMEGA (1995-03) 4DR SALOON 2.2I 16V CDX AUTO is often used as a dependable used car for individuals seeking a budget-friendly yet well-loved saloon. With an average recorded mileage of around 86,594 miles and a typical ownership of about five to six years, it tends to appeal to second or third owners who appreciate its spaciousness and smooth automatic transmission. When compared to rivals, it’s praised for its robust build, comfortable interior, and decent fuel economy. The data indicates that all vehicles of the Vauxhall Omega (1995-03) 4DR Saloon 2.2I 16V CDX Auto model are uniformly equipped with a 2,198cc engine and exclusively utilize petrol as their primary fuel source. This suggests a consistent engine specification and fuel type across this model, which could be valuable information for buyers or part suppliers focusing on standard configurations for this vehicle.
